In the case of a volatile sample, such as with fuels analysis, larger
amounts of sample can be applied without concern of leakage or
damage to the instrument, however, using the smallest amount of
sample possible will ease in the cleaning process.
Although it is safe to run a variety of lubrication samples, including
aqueous solutions or even thick pastes such as grease, the TumblIR is
not to be used with any solid samples, such as hard graphite
lubricant. Use of the TumblIR with solid samples will damage the
ZnSe windows.
